Airbnb reported first‑quarter 2026 earnings per share (EPS) of $0.26, falling short of the consensus estimate of $0.2951 by approximately 11.89%. Revenue details were not provided in the available data. Following the announcement, the stock edged up 0.25%. The EPS miss may raise questions about near‑term profitability and cost management.

Airbnb’s EPS of $0.26 for Q1 2026 fell below analyst expectations, suggesting possible pressure on margins or higher operating expenses during the seasonally weaker quarter. Although specific revenue and booking figures were not disclosed in this release, the company has historically experienced softer demand in the first quarter compared to peak travel seasons. The EPS miss may reflect moderating average daily rates, increased marketing spend to drive bookings, or higher fixed costs. The modest stock gain of 0.25% indicates that some investors may view the miss as temporary or already priced in. Without revenue data, it is difficult to assess whether top‑line growth is keeping pace with the broader travel recovery. Airbnb’s focus on expanding its host base and improving platform quality likely remains a priority, but near‑term profitability could be affected by competitive pressures and inflation‑sensitive consumer behavior. The company’s ability to manage costs and maintain take rates will be key to restoring margin expectations. The stock’s 0.25% uptick after the release suggests that the EPS miss was largely anticipated by the market or that investors are focused on longer‑term growth prospects rather than the quarterly deviation. Analysts may revise their near‑term EPS forecasts downward given the 11.89% surprise, but they could also highlight Airbnb’s strong brand and network effects as buffers against volatility. Key factors to watch include the company’s ability to grow nights and experiences booked, its advertising efficiency, and any progress in expanding non‑core services. The lack of revenue disclosure in this data set leaves a notable information gap; full financial filings will be critical for a complete assessment. Going forward, Airbnb may need to demonstrate consistent margin improvement to justify its current valuation. Any signs of accelerating demand or successful cost‑control measures could quickly shift sentiment. The next earnings report will be pivotal in confirming whether Q1 2026 was a temporary setback or the start of a longer pattern.
